GM gears EN-V for urban environments
The first time we saw General Motors' EN-V concept vehicle was a couple of weeks ago when it was unveiled in Shanghai, China.
In this YouTube video, Chris Borroni-Bird, director of EN-V program, explains how GM designed the vehicle to change the way urban dwellers get around the city.
EN-V's platform evolved from the Personal Urban Mobility and Accessibility prototype that Segway developed--it even looks like a Segway in a bubble.
